#bc0918 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#bc0918 is composed of 73.7% red, 3.5% green and 9.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 95.2% magenta, 87.2% yellow and 26.3% black. It has a hue angle of 355 degrees, a saturation of 90.9% and a lightness of 38.6%. #bc0918 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ff1230 with #790000. Closest websafe color is: #cc0000.

● #bc0918 color description : Strong red.
#bc0918 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#bc0918 has RGB values of R:188, G:9, B:24 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.95, Y:0.87, K:0.26. Its decimal value is 12323096.

Shades and Tints of #bc0918
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010000 is the darkest color, while #feedef is the lightest one.
